摘要
本文利用弹性理论推导了煤层底板任意点的应力计算公式。提出了通过计算岩石的强度指数来预计煤层底板的破坏深度。依据底板破坏深度与承压水的“原始导高”的关系预测煤层底板突水的可能性,并以现场实测数据验证了这种计算方法的可靠性。图5,表2,参考文献2。
Using the elastic theory,the author has derived the formula of the stress calculation in the seam floor, and advances that the failure depth of floor can be estimated by calculating the strength index of rock. There is a possibility in the seam floor according to the relation between the failure depth of floor and the initial raising height of pressure water and it can be confirmed by the in-situ data.
